Practitioner training on Roadmap Directives (completed)

June 1, 2014

 



The project aims to contribute to the successful implementation of EU Procedural Rights Directives and to educate the practitioners on how the EU law instruments can be used to challenge systemic problems within justice systems.


Project period 2014 06 01 – 2016 06 30
Partnership Lithuania, United Kingdom, Greece, Hungary, Poland, Romania
Project snapshot
Achievements

 

1. We organized residential practitioners training in Vilnius where 40 criminal lawyers from Estonia, Latvia, Lithuania, Finland, Sweden and Denmark took part.

2. The training curriculum covered the new EU directives on fair trial rights in criminal proceedings, including the right to information, the right to translation, the right to a lawyer and others.
